Do universities have different budget requirements for overseas education in UK/Singapore?
Yes, universities have different budget requirements for overseas education. Costs vary mainly due to differences in tuition fees and living expenses by country and institution.
- Tuition fees: Vary widely between universities and countries. For example, Singapore's public universities offer subsidized fees with a work commitment, while fees in the US and UK can be much higher and depend on the type of institution.
- Living expenses: Also differ by location, with cities like Singapore, London, or New York typically being more expensive than smaller towns.
- Additional costs: Scholarships, exchange rates, visa fees, and insurance are other factors that can affect your total budget.
